    Position Summary

    The Medical Assistant supports urgent care providers with clinical and administrative tasks, including patient intake, vitals, testing, procedures, room preparation, and EMR documentation. This role delivers a high‑quality, customer‑focused experience in a fast‑paced care setting.

    Essential Functions

    • Register patients, verify insurance, and collect co-pays
    • Schedule appointments and coordinate specialist referrals
    • Respond to patient inquiries and provide care status updates
    • Communicate patient flow and assist with patient preparation
    • Record medical history and obtain vital signs
    • Perform point-of-care testing (flu, strep, ECG)
    • Perform phlebotomy and administer injections
    • Prepare, clean, and restock exam rooms
    • Update EMR and scan documents
    • Answer phones and manage administrative tasks
    • Conduct patient follow-up and maintain reception area
    • Complete opening and closing procedures, including cash-out
    • Conduct daily equipment checks and submit repair tickets
    • Perform additional duties as assigned

    Certification Requirements (for candidates with less than 3 years of MA experience)

    One of the following certifications is required:

    • CCMA – Certified Clinical Medical Assistant (NHA)
    • CMA – Certified Medical Assistant (AAMA or CHP)
    • RMA – Registered Medical Assistant (AMT, AAH, or ARMA)
    • NCMA – National Certified Medical Assistant (NCCT)
    • NRCMA – Nationally Registered Certified Medical Assistant (NAHP)

    Certification Alternatives

    Experience-Based Pathway (no MA certification at hire)

    Candidates may qualify with:

    • A minimum of 3 years of Medical Assistant experience, AND
    • At least 1 of those years must be in a Hospital, Emergency Room, or Urgent Care setting

    Note: Individuals hired without an approved MA certification must obtain one within 6 months of their start date to remain eligible for continued employment.

    Alternative Credentials Accepted at Time of Hire

    • Graduate of an accredited Nursing Program, LPN, or RN
    • EMT (National Registry of Emergency Medical Technicians)
    • Paramedic (National Registry of Emergency Medical Technicians)
    • CNA – Certified Nursing Assistant
